IltmsLogInformation::get_Referrer

Summary

Retrieves the site that the user last visited.

Syntax

#include "ltms.h"

Language Syntax
C HRESULT IltmsLogInformation_get_Referrer(pLogInformation, pVal)
C++ HRESULT get_Referrer(pVal)

Parameters

IltmsLogInformation *pLogInformation

Pointer to an IltmsLogInformation interface.

BSTR *pVal

Pointer to a string variable that receives the site that the user last visited. This site.

Returns

Value Meaning
S_OK The function was successful.
<> S_OK An error occurred. Refer to the Error Codes or the HRESULT error codes in the DirectShow documentation.

Comments

The pVal parameter points to the site that provided a link to the current site. The string is empty if no site was specified.

If the function succeeds, the caller must free the returned BSTR value by calling the SysFreeString function.
